Given Riverton's rural Litchfield County roads and seasonal weather, we frequently address suspension components worn by potholes, AWD system maintenance for winter conditions, and electrical issues related to moisture. Volvos from the 2000s era also commonly need PCV system service, which is critical for long-term engine health in our climate.
Look for a shop that is a member of the Volvo Independent Specialist Network (VISN) or employs ASE-certified technicians with Volvo-specific training. In the Riverton/Barkhamsted area, a quality shop will have a strong local reputation, use genuine or high-quality OEM parts, and have advanced diagnostic tools like VIDA for modern Volvo computer systems.

Yes, Volvo repair and maintenance costs are generally higher than for mainstream brands due to specialized parts and technology. However, using a trusted local independent specialist in Riverton can be 20-40% less expensive than the dealership for labor, and they can often offer more cost-effective, high-quality part alternatives without compromising reliability.
The hilly terrain, gravel backroads, and significant winter salt use in Litchfield County mean you should prioritize more frequent undercarriage washes to combat rust, earlier brake and tire inspections, and vigilant AWD system checks. These conditions accelerate wear on suspension, brakes, and corrosion-prone areas specific to Volvo models.
